## Requirements
### Metadata
Redshift user must grant `SELECT` privilege on table [SVV_TABLE_INFO](https://docs.aws.amazon.com/redshift/latest/dg/r_SVV_TABLE_INFO.html) to fetch the metadata of tables and views. For more information visit [here](https://docs.aws.amazon.com/redshift/latest/dg/c_visibility-of-data.html).
```sql
-- Create a new user
-- More details https://docs.aws.amazon.com/redshift/latest/dg/r_CREATE_USER.html
CREATE USER test_user with PASSWORD 'password';
-- Grant SELECT on table
GRANT SELECT ON TABLE svv_table_info to test_user;
```
{% note %}
Ensure that the ingestion user has **USAGE** privileges on the schema containing the views. If additional access is needed, run the following command:
```sql
GRANT USAGE ON SCHEMA "<schema_name>" TO <ingestion_user>;
```
{% /note %}

### Profiler & Data Quality
Executing the profiler workflow or data quality tests, will require the user to have `SELECT` permission on the tables/schemas where the profiler/tests will be executed. More information on the profiler workflow setup can be found [here](/how-to-guides/data-quality-observability/profiler/workflow) and data quality tests [here](/how-to-guides/data-quality-observability/quality).
2024-06-18 15:53:06 +02:00
### Usage & Lineage
For the usage and lineage workflow, the user will need `SELECT` privilege on `STL_QUERY` table. You can find more information on the usage workflow [here](/connectors/ingestion/workflows/usage) and the lineage workflow [here](/connectors/ingestion/workflows/lineage).

#### Connection Details
- **Username**: Specify the User to connect to Redshift. It should have enough privileges to read all the metadata.
- **Password**: Password to connect to Redshift.
- **Database**: The database of the data source is an optional parameter, if you would like to restrict the metadata reading to a single database. If left blank, OpenMetadata ingestion attempts to scan all the databases.

{% note %}
During the metadata ingestion for redshift, the tables in which the distribution style i.e, `DISTSTYLE` is not `AUTO` will be marked as partitioned tables
{% /note %}
**SSL Configuration**
In order to integrate SSL in the Metadata Ingestion Config, the user will have to add the SSL config under connectionArguments which is placed in the source.
**SSL Modes**
There are a couple of types of SSL modes that Redshift supports which can be added to ConnectionArguments, they are as follows:
- **disable**: SSL is disabled and the connection is not encrypted.
- **allow**: SSL is used if the server requires it.
- **prefer**: SSL is used if the server supports it. Amazon Redshift supports SSL, so SSL is used when you set sslmode to prefer.
- **require**: SSL is required.
- **verify-ca**: SSL must be used and the server certificate must be verified.
- **verify-full**: SSL must be used. The server certificate must be verified and the server hostname must match the hostname attribute on the certificate.
For more information, you can visit [Redshift SSL documentation](https://docs.aws.amazon.com/redshift/latest/mgmt/connecting-ssl-support.html)

## Securing Redshift Connection with SSL in OpenMetadata
To establish secure connections between OpenMetadata and a Redshift database, you can configure SSL using different SSL modes provided by Redshift, each offering varying levels of security.
Under `Advanced Config`, specify the SSL mode appropriate for your connection, such as `prefer`, `verify-ca`, `allow`, and others. After selecting the SSL mode, provide the CA certificate used for SSL validation (`caCertificate`). Note that Redshift requires only the CA certificate for SSL validation.
